- 1、本文档共198页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
大家好,我是你们的新朋友,也是你们学习易语言的好伙伴。
那什么是易语言呢?
易语言是由飞扬工作室出品的 Windows 环境下的全中文实用电脑程序编写语言,她支持现今所有的 Windows 32 位操作系统,即:Windows 9X、ME、2000、NT 等,提供了中国电脑用户开发 Windows 应用程序最方便直观、快捷实用的方法,适合于初中级别电脑用户使用。尤其是根本不懂英文或者英文了解很少的初级用户,可以通过使用本语言极其快速地进入 Windows 程序编写的大门。
大家一听说编程就头大哦,易语言其实并不可怕,在这本书里,我会带你们一步一步地走进易语言其乐无穷的世界。
同学们,你们一定对编程既神往又望而生畏吧?有很多人想学编程,但他们一看到满屏都是英文,通常的反映就是:“呵,还要学英文哪?”、“为什么用‘如果...那么...’就可以表达清楚的意思却非要用‘if...then...’呢?”,基本上就放弃了。不是他们不想学,实在是门槛太高。我由衷地希望易语言能够在这方面帮助大家。另外易语言对于在校学生尤其合适,因为他们基本上没有或者很少有计算机专业英语能力,但在这方面的求知欲又非常强,易语言能够完全满足他们在这方面的需要,培养他们的兴趣,引导他们入门,以期得到更大的发展。易语言里面提供流程图功能很大意义上就是基于这个用户群体。还有很多DOS程序员未能成功地转向Windows,易语言对于他们也非常合适。
易语言与其他编程语言相比,更值得我们国内大多数编程爱好者学习,可以说是学习编程最好的入门语言之一。学好了易语言,再学其他编程语言,你就会感觉很容易明白了,但是对于一般人来说,你如果先去学其他编程语言,会感觉非常困难,很容易就放弃。对于国内爱好者来说,易语言最通俗易懂、最易学,并且程序开发效率也最高。
为什么这么说?因为易语言与其它编程语言相比,具有以下主要优点:
一、全可视化支持。
一般的可视化编程语言,仅支持图形用户界面的可视化设计操作,而易语言除了支持此类可视化,还支持程序流程的即时可视化呈视。即:用户在编写程序的过程中,可以即时看到当前程序的运行流程及路线,以助于培养编程思路,提高解决编程问题的能力;
二、全中文支持。
作为一款由中国人自己设计的编程语言,易语言在中文处理方面做了大量的工作。用户在编写程序的过程中如果愿意,可以不接触任何英文。根本不懂英文或者英文了解很少的用户可以直接使用本语言来编写程序,不存在任何障碍。
1、中文名称的快速录入。易语言内置四种名称输入法:首拼、全拼、双拼、英文。三种拼音输入法均全面支持南方音。使用这些输入法用户能够以英文语句的录入速度来录入全中文程序语句。
2、程序全部以中文方式显示,运算符号全部显示为对应的中文符号,日期时间以中文格式呈现,以便于我国用户理解、阅读程序。
3、以中文作为编程语言可以做到望文生义、望文知义,非常接近于自然语言,并且汉语的语法、逻辑在中文编程中可以得到充分的体现,更加适合中国人使用。对其它计算机编程语言的学习,总会感到某种限制,首先是语言环境的限制,也许熟练的英文能够多少得到一点补偿,但很多英文却总是有点半懂不懂,因为受语言本身的限制,英文已经无法表达清楚,只好用一些单词的部分字头进行组合,实际上早已失掉了本身的含义,从字母本身的组合上来看已经完全没有意义,只不过是一种强行的规定而已。初学者对此可能不清楚,英文编程语言中有很多术语是英文单词中原本没有的,如“IDTExtensibility”之类,单看字面我们无法知道这个术语的意思。这种脱离人类自然语言的东西不可避免地为我们理解编程造成无法解决的困难。
4、语言中专门提供了适合中国国情的命令,如中文格式日期时间处理、汉字发音处理、全半角字符处理、人民币金额处理等等。以后此方面将会继续得到大量扩充及增强。
三、易语言由基本系统和运行支持库两部分组成,两者之间通过使用飞扬工作室自行定义的接口技术进行协作。运行支持库内提供了易语言的所有语言要素,如:命令、窗口和报表单元数据类型、普通数据类型、常量等等,还可以通过提供“加入(AddIn)”功能来扩充易语言基本系统。运行支持库可以被随意增减、抽换或升级,基本系统对运行支持库提供了详细的版本控制。本技术给用户带来的最大好处是:
1、用户可以根据行业或自身需要定制易语言;
2、由于运行支持库的不断增多、升级,易语言的功能将被迅速扩充;
3、由于运行支持库可以仅包含声明而不包含实际的运行支持代码,并且可以随时被更新或抽换,这样可使人们通过国际互联网与服务器进行远程易语言交流(譬如复杂型电子商务、远程控制等等)成为
您可能关注的文档
最近下载
- 系统架构设计师高级系统架构原理与原则.pptx VIP
- 1第1章 After Effects入门知识《After Effects 影视后期制作教程》.ppt
- 系统架构设计师高级业务需求分析与架构设计.pptx VIP
- 2024-2025学年北京房山区九年级初三(上)期末数学试卷(含答案).pdf
- pc104总线模块522pc系列总线.ppt
- 系统架构设计师高级数据架构与存储策略.pptx VIP
- 高中英语词组(短语)及固定搭配500个.docx VIP
- 胃肠镜检查注意事项ppt课件.pdf VIP
- 分型笔线段终极版动画日记.ppt
- 2024年江苏省盐城市小学数学四上期末考试试题含解析.doc VIP
文档评论(0)